A member asked:

My baby is a month old and is being breast feed and i recently noticed that the inner part of her lips have turned black.. ?

Sucking blister: Babies can get a little "sucking blister" from nursing. Most commonly it occurs on the top lip, but can also be the bottom lip. Just before she latches, with her mouth wide, take your index finger and roll the top lip outward, to get the lip tissue out of the way of the breast. Be sure and mention to your pediatrician at the one month visit so she can rule out heart disease, also.

Breast feeding: please have your pediatrician rule out congenital heart disease as the cause of the discoloration, as this could be a sign reffered to as cyanosis.
